Photo courtesy of Cynthia Rowley Rowley has entered into a partnership with the Dessy Group to create a collection of bridesmaid dresses inspired by her ready-to-wear collection. Set to hit bridal stores in June, the collection will have many of the design elements Rowley's clothes are known for like tulle skirts and drop-waist silhouettes. The floor- and tea-length dresses will be appropriate for both day and evening weddings. "We wanted to bring a chic sensibility to bridesmaids dresses -- a look that is pretty yet sophisticated," Rowley said in a press release. Dresses in the 20-piece collection will retail for $175-$220, making them a designer steal. And though every bride says, "You can wear it again," when forcing her bridesmaids into Pepto pink dresses, now the statement may finally hold true. Rowley is not completely new to the bridal industry; she has designed one-of-a-kind dresses for private clients and friends. And what goes perfectly with Cynthia Rowley's new collection? Maxx and Marshalls Over Alleged Counterfeits Filed under: Fashion, News, Designers & Brands Burberry is in the legal trenches again to stop alleged counterfeiting. Photo: Stefanie Keenan, WireImage Fendi recently won an impressive $4.7 million dollar judgement against Burlington Coat Factory for continuing to sell fake Fendi bags. Now, Burberry claims TJX Co., the parent company of discount chains including T.J. Maxx and Marshalls, has been selling counterfeits in mass quantities, Reuters reports. While millions of discount shoppers thought they were getting a designer steal, the Brit label headed to Manhattan federal court alleging that TJX has sold everything from counterfeit Burberry jackets, photo frames, polo shirts to scarves and luggage, over a span of four years. According to the complaint, Burberry is hopping mad over TJX's attempt "to attract their target customer base and profit at Burberry's expense." Not only is the luxury brand asking the court to stop the sale of the allegedly infringing products, but its lawyers are asking for triple damages and that TJX place "corrective advertisements." From Burberry's courtroom track record, TJX better bring its legal A-game. The company known for its classic trenches recently took home a cool $1.5 million from a trademark infringement suit. Photo: PRNewsFoto/Interscope Records We previously showed you one of the film stills that the flamboyant diva leaked of her new video for Beyoncé-assisted hit single "Telephone," in which Gaga wears her hair in the shape of a, well, telephone. And now the oft-pantless pop star is wetting our appetites further by putting three new images of the video on the Web in anticipation of the actual premiere of the video tomorrow (March 11). "What I like about it is it's a real true pop event," Gaga told KIIS-FM's Ryan Seacrest last month about the video. "When I was younger I was always excited when there was a big giant event happening in pop music and that's what I wanted this to be." In a new press release, the nine-minute Jonas Akerlund-directed video is described as "gritty, erotic and wildly fierce," as well as a "visually stunning, cinematic masterpiece... rich with Gaga's unique dance stylings, iconic costume design and unworldly hair and make-up, this is far from your typical music video." Lady Gaga goes rock 'n' roller. Photo: PRNewsFoto/Interscope Records So far seven film stills from the new video have been released, including two with telephone-fashioned hair and headpieces, a couple of Gaga in a Wonder Woman-like stars-and-stripes bikini and another of her completely naked, wrapped in yellow police tape. The newest images feature Gaga as a "Grease"-era biker, in a studded leather jacket with Coke can rollers in her platinum hair; the other finds her wrapped in chains (over a beaded gown), sporting sunglasses made of cigarettes. The last of the new images gives us our first look at Beyoncé, who previously tapped Gaga to be in her sexy "Video Phone" video. This time around, B dons shredded denim short-shorts, a bedazzled jacket and pumps that scream '90s Versace and a Betty Page 'do. Beyoncé, clearly not a fan of the hold music. Photo: PRNewsFoto/Interscope Records "Telephone" is the second single from Lady Gaga's platinum album "The Fame Monster." The video for her first single, "Bad Romance," features Gaga wearing the famed armadillo heels by late designer Alexander McQueen. I'm a 31 year old mom and I've always wondered what it would be like to be the girl that no one notices. As an Italian, I take pride in my "flaw" but I am curious about what a downgrade in size would do to my appearance. I've recently lost about 35 lbs and as my body shrunk, my nose mysteriously grew! The patient before (left) and after (right) hypothetical rhinoplasty and neck liposuction. Courtesy Photo Dr. Freund's Answer: I understand your concerns and have shown you in the "After" photos what a small reduction in the bump would do for you. Let me reassure you that overall your nose is not bad to start with and rhinoplasty surgery would make subtle improvements. Perhaps more important is the excess fat under your neck. It's great that you've lost some weight recently, and you should continue to address this issue. Interestingly, you mention that after your weight loss that your nose appeared larger. More likely, as your face got smaller your nose stayed the same, but it appeared larger. I have also demonstrated what your neck may look like if you lost more weight or had liposuction there. The cost for neck liposuction should be under $5,000, and the downtime is minimal, so you might want to consider that, if you do anything at all. Meanwhile, keep dropping those pounds.
